Nanotechnology Centre for PVD Research
The centre is renowned for development of nanoscale multilayer Physical Vapour Deposited (PVD) coatings and for the development of the HIPIMS technique.

Particle and powder flows during industrial processes
The conduct of this project would help to gain deeper physical and theoretical insights into the granular processes involved with segregation, mixing, avalanching, shock surface and rheology etc., hence providing guidance to relevant application problems.

Microscope imaging
In microscope applications, many of the imaging and vision techniques that are generally applied in industrial macro-environments are not suitable because of several constraints imposed by the micro-environment
Expertise in clay-based polymer nanocomposites
We have extensive experience of incorporating clays into a range of petroleum derived polymers including polypropylene, polyamide, polyacrylates, polycaprolactone, polyvinylalcohol as well as biopolymers including starch, polylactic acid, chitosan and gelatin
